Harbour street

In this evocative street scene from around 1890, we step into Tin Ghaut, a narrow cobbled alley leading to Whitby’s bustling harbour. Women carry baskets on their heads, a curious cat sniffs the ground, and a young girl rests on a stoop, quietly watching daily life unfold.

In the misty distance, tall ship masts pierce the sky, reminding us that Whitby was once a vital hub of fishing, trade, and maritime adventure. The image speaks of resilience, rhythm, and community in a time when the sea ruled all.
